Overview

ROBINSON MILLS & WILLIAMS is an award-winning architecture and interior design practice known for its collaborative studio culture and focus on creating engaging workplaces for leading companies. The firm is growing and is looking for an Architecture Designer 1 to contribute to its San Francisco studio.

Role Summary

This position supports the development of architectural work across multiple project stages, from early programming and field checks through conceptual design, schematic design, design development, construction documentation, and construction administration. The role is collaborative and includes guidance from designers and architects.

Responsibilities

  • Assist with developing design ideas and preparing supporting documentation.
  • Apply design judgment with attention to form, color, and material selection while solving problems.
  • Coordinate with the Project Manager, Job Captain, and other teammates on programming, design direction, and scheduling to keep work moving appropriately.
  • Create 3D studies, models, drawings, and renderings with supervision.
  • Prepare presentation materials that clearly communicate design concepts.
  • Build familiarity with building codes and related technical requirements.
  • Help produce design and construction document sets.
  • Support decisions around materials, finishes, furniture, and building systems.
